Factors Influencing Pricing
The final price you receive from Geogreenpower.com will depend on a combination of these elements:
- System Size and Capacity:
- Solar PV: The larger the solar array measured in kilowatts-peak, kWp, the higher the cost. This depends on your energy consumption needs, available roof space, and desired energy independence. For commercial installations, this can range from tens of thousands to hundreds of thousands of pounds. For domestic systems, typical residential installations might range from £5,000 to £15,000+ depending on size e.g., a 4kWp system vs. an 8kWp system.
- Battery Storage: Battery capacity measured in kilowatt-hours, kWh and the type of battery technology e.g., Tesla Powerwall, LG Chem, etc. directly impact the price. Costs can vary significantly, from £3,000 to £10,000+ for residential batteries.
- Heat Pumps: The size of the heat pump kW output required to adequately heat your property, whether it’s an air source or ground source system, and the complexity of installation will influence the cost. Ground source systems generally have higher initial costs due to groundworks but can be more efficient. Domestic air source heat pumps might range from £7,000 to £18,000, while ground source systems can be £15,000 to £30,000+.
- Property Type and Complexity:
- Roof Type/Condition: The material, pitch, and condition of your roof can affect installation complexity and cost for solar panels.
- Ground Conditions: For ground source heat pumps, the geological conditions of your land will dictate the ease and cost of trenching or drilling for the ground loop.
- Existing Infrastructure: The state of your current electrical system, heating system, and grid connection will determine if upgrades are needed, adding to the overall cost.
- Accessibility: Difficult-to-access sites or roofs can increase labor costs.
- Component Quality and Brand: Geo Green Power works with various reputable brands e.g., Canadian Solar, Tesla, NIBE. Premium brands often come with higher price tags but may offer better efficiency, longer warranties, or advanced features.
- Installation Requirements:
- Labor Costs: The number of installers required and the duration of the project.
- Scaffolding/Access Equipment: Necessary for safe installation on roofs.
- Electrical Work: Wiring, inverter installation, and integration with your home’s or business’s electrical system.
- Planning Permissions/Permits: While often handled by the installer, there might be associated fees.
- Additional Services: Any add-ons like ongoing maintenance contracts, monitoring systems, or bespoke energy management solutions will impact the total price.

Commercial Solar Funding and Business Grants
For businesses looking to invest in renewable energy, the upfront capital outlay can be substantial.
Geogreenpower.com addresses this by highlighting various funding avenues: Empowerservers.com Reviews
- Asset Finance: This is a common method where businesses lease or hire the solar equipment rather than buying it outright. This allows them to spread the cost over time, preserving working capital. Geo Green Power provides information and likely connects businesses with partners offering asset finance solutions.
- Benefit: Enables businesses to acquire solar energy systems without a large upfront payment, making sustainable upgrades more accessible.
- Example from their blog: Their blog post “Asset Finance for solar: Three solid examples of success” delves into practical applications and benefits.
- Power Purchase Agreements PPAs: A PPA is a contractual agreement where a third-party provider the PPA provider installs, owns, and maintains the solar system on a business’s property. The business then purchases the electricity generated by the system at a pre-agreed, often lower, rate than grid electricity.
- Benefit: Zero upfront cost for the business, predictable energy costs, and immediate savings on electricity bills.
- Key advantage: Shifts the operational and maintenance burden to the PPA provider.
- Example from their blog: “Power Purchase Agreement for Solar: Six reasons to act now” illustrates the compelling advantages of this model.

Solar Grants for Home Owners
For domestic clients, government support plays a crucial role in making renewable heating and electricity more accessible:
- Boiler Upgrade Scheme BUS: This is a flagship UK government scheme designed to encourage homeowners to install low-carbon heating systems like air source and ground source heat pumps.
- Grant amounts: As of early 2024, the scheme offers £7,500 towards the cost of purchasing and installing an air source heat pump or a ground source heat pump.
- Eligibility: Typically, the property must be in England or Wales, have an eligible heat pump installed by an MCS Microgeneration Certification Scheme certified installer, and meet certain energy performance criteria.
- How Geo Green Power helps: They are an MCS-certified installer, meaning they can apply for the grant on behalf of eligible homeowners, simplifying the process.
- VAT Reduction: A significant financial benefit for homeowners is the 0% VAT rate applied to the installation of energy-saving materials, including solar panels, battery storage, and heat pumps, in domestic properties. This applies to both the equipment and the installation service, resulting in considerable savings compared to standard VAT rates.
- Smart Export Guarantee SEG: While not a grant, the SEG is a government-backed initiative that requires larger electricity suppliers to pay small-scale low-carbon electricity generators like homeowners with solar panels for the electricity they export back to the grid.
- Benefit: Provides an additional revenue stream for homeowners, improving the return on investment for solar PV systems.

Industry Trends and Future Outlook
The renewable energy sector in the UK, and globally, is experiencing rapid growth and innovation.
Growth of Renewable Energy Adoption
The UK has ambitious targets for decarbonization. Printerdoctor.info Reviews
The government aims for a significant increase in renewable energy generation as part of its net-zero by 2050 commitment.
- Solar Power: Solar PV installations continue to grow. According to MCS data, by the end of 2023, there were over 1.4 million MCS-certified installations in the UK, with solar PV being the dominant technology. The cost of solar panels has also decreased dramatically over the past decade, making them more financially attractive.
- Battery Storage: The uptake of battery storage is accelerating, driven by decreasing costs and the desire for greater energy independence and optimization e.g., storing cheap off-peak electricity or surplus solar. The UK’s energy storage capacity is projected to expand significantly.
- Heat Pumps: Heat pumps are central to the UK’s strategy to decarbonize heating. The Boiler Upgrade Scheme is a key driver, aiming for 600,000 heat pump installations per year by 2028. Heat pump installations increased by 36% in 2023 compared to 2022, according to the Heat Pump Association.
- Electric Vehicles EVs and Charging Infrastructure: The ban on new petrol and diesel car sales by 2035 is fueling massive demand for EV charging solutions. The number of public charge points in the UK grew by 45% in 22023, reaching over 56,000. Home charging, a key service offered by Geo Green Power, is equally critical.
Key Industry Trends
- Integration and Smart Energy Management: The future is moving towards integrated home and business energy systems. This involves smart inverters, energy management systems EMS, and smart home devices that optimize energy flow between solar, battery, EV charging, and grid. Geo Green Power’s comprehensive offerings align well with this trend.
- Grid Services and Flexibility: Distributed energy resources like rooftop solar and batteries are increasingly seen as assets that can provide flexibility to the grid, for example, by discharging stored energy during peak demand. This could open new revenue streams for system owners.
- Digitalization: Advanced monitoring platforms, AI-driven energy optimization, and digital tools for customer interaction are becoming standard.
- Circular Economy: A growing focus on the recyclability of solar panels and batteries, and sustainable sourcing of materials.
- Government Policy and Incentives: Continued support from government policies and grant schemes will be crucial for sustained growth. The UK’s commitment to renewable energy targets provides a stable policy environment.
